What happens in the book unwind?
Unwind is a dystopian thriller by Neal Shusterman that follows three teens on the run from a government that believes “unwinding,” or body harvesting, is an alternate solution to abortions and unwanted teens. Unwinding is also a choice for extremely religious families who want to tithe one of their teens.

Why does Connor save Lev?
In chapter 4, Connor says that he decided in “a split-second decision” to rescue Lev because he felt that he needed to “balance” the harm he had already done with “something decent.” Connor says that he was already responsible for the bus driver’s death and “maybe more,” and that, even “if it risk[ed] everything,” he …
Does Lev want to be unwound?
He has known and accepted that he was to be unwound because of Pastor Dan. Lev is also naive in the beginning. Eventually, he learns to be intelligent street-wise as he finds ways to escape from Connor and Risa’s clutches and also knows that getting on their good side might help him escape.

What is the plot in the book unwind?
Unwind Plot Summary. Unwind is set in a dystopian setting, or a genre that focuses on a dark inversion of utopian society. Taking place in this dystopian United States, Unwind begins at the end of the Second Civil War. The war was over the morality of abortion.

What was the setting in the book unwind?
The setting changes to many different places throughout the entire story. These settings are in chronological order according to the book. The first main setting in Unwind is the woods. The woods is where Connor, Risa and Lev first meet. The second main setting is the high school.
